Key Trade-offs & Our Top Pick
1. Elegant Folding Screens
– Pros:
– Easy to set up and take down when needed.
– Adds a decorative touch to your space.
– Cons:
– Might not provide complete privacy.
– Can tip over if not anchored properly.
– Best for: Temporary divisions when hosting guests or creating a cozy reading nook.
2. Cozy Curtain Dividers
– Pros:
– Inexpensive and available in various colors and patterns.
– Flexible and can be opened or closed as needed.
– Cons:
– May gather dust and require regular cleaning.
– Can block light if closed, making a space feel smaller.
– Best for: Creating a soft division in a shared bedroom for privacy without permanently altering the space.
3. Stylish Bookshelves
– Pros:
– Offers storage space along with division.
– Can be styled with decor or plants to enhance your room.
– Cons:
– Takes up floor space and may look bulky in small rooms.
– Requires effort to set up and may need securing.
– Best for: Dividing spaces in a home office or bedroom while keeping your books and decor within reach.
4. Chic Sliding Doors
– Pros:
– Provides a sleek, modern look and is space-efficient.
– Offers strong privacy when closed.
– Cons:
– Installation can be complex and might require professional help.
– Limited design options compared to other dividers.
– Best for: Permanent divisions in small apartments, giving a modern flair while enhancing isolation.
5. Multi-functional Furniture
– Pros:
– Serves multiple purposes, such as a bed with storage underneath.
– Helps maximize small spaces effectively.
– Cons:
– Can be more expensive initially than traditional furniture.
– May not fit all styles or aesthetics.
– Best for: Small bedrooms where every inch counts and functionality is key.

10. Creative Use of Rugs
Rugs are a subtle yet impactful way to delineate areas within your bedroom. By strategically placing rugs, you can create visual separation without the need for physical barriers. Selecting rugs that complement your decor while varying textures and patterns can help establish distinct zones.
For example, a plush area rug can define your sleeping space, while a smaller, vibrant rug can mark a workspace or reading nook. Layering rugs adds depth and comfort to your decor, enhancing the overall feel of the room. Be mindful of the size and shape of your rugs to ensure they fit well within each designated area.
Consider these tips for using rugs creatively:
– Mix patterns and textures for a bohemian flair.
– Ensure rug sizes are proportionate to surrounding furniture.
– Choose colors that harmonize with your overall decor.
Rugs provide a simple and stylish solution for creating distinct zones in your bedroom while enhancing both comfort and aesthetic appeal.

How do I measure and install a room divider to create instant zones without professional help?
Begin by measuring width, height, and any doorway or window clearances to determine the divider size. Decide whether you want a freestanding option or a mounted solution (like a curtain track). For freestanding screens, ensure a stable base or weighted panels to prevent tipping. If you choose curtains, install a track or rod with mounting hardware appropriate for your wall type. Always leave enough clearance for movement and lighting, and test the layout before adding hardware. With careful measuring and the right product, you can implement stylish partition ideas quickly and safely.
